The Fokker F28 Fellowship is a twin-engined, short-range jet airliner designed and built by the Dutch manufacturer Fokker, developed as a turbofan-powered complement to the company's successful F27 Friendship turboprop. Aimed squarely at regional operators needing speed without sacrificing access to shorter runways, it competed directly with the Douglas DC-9 and BAC 1-11, and 241 were built between 1967 and 1987. For simmer pilots it offers a compact, mechanically distinctive 1960s-70s European regional jet with an unusual tail-mounted airbrake and a still-active presence with a small number of operators.

Overview

The Fokker F28 Fellowship is a twin-engined, short-range regional jet airliner produced by the Dutch manufacturer Fokker, built as a jet-powered complement to the earlier F27 Friendship turboprop. It seated between roughly 65 and 85 passengers depending on variant and was designed to operate from many of the same shorter regional airfields already served by the F27 and the Douglas DC-3, while offering considerably higher speed. It sat within the same market segment as the Douglas DC-9 and British BAC 1-11, though it was deliberately slower than those types in exchange for simplicity and short-field capability. The type led directly to the later Fokker 70 and Fokker 100 derivatives.

History & Development

By 1960 Fokker was already established as a manufacturer of the commercially successful F27 Friendship turboprop, and around that time British European Airways issued a specification for a high-speed regional airliner powered by turbofans, prompting Fokker to develop its own short-haul jet. In April 1962 Fokker formally announced the launch of the F28 Fellowship, publicly unveiling the project at the Hannover Air Show. The programme was a multinational collaboration between Fokker, the West German companies Messerschmitt-Bölkow-Blohm (MBB) and VFW-Fokker, and Short Brothers of Northern Ireland, with substantial government backing: the Dutch government funded around 50% of Fokker's stake, and the West German government covered about 60% of the German partners' contribution. Fokker had also approached Sud Aviation and Hawker Siddeley about involvement. Design and production responsibilities were split between the partners, with Fokker building the nose section, centre fuselage and inner wing, MBB/Fokker-VFW producing the forward fuselage, rear fuselage and tail assembly, and Shorts building the outer wings; final assembly took place at Schiphol Airport. Early design work centred on a 50-seat aircraft with a range of up to 1,650 km (1,025 mi), but market research, especially in North America, led Fokker to enlarge the design to a 65-seat, five-abreast layout, broadly comparable in capacity to the Vickers Viscount. Fokker had at one stage intended to power the aircraft with Bristol Siddeley BS.75 turbofans, but when contract negotiations opened Bristol Siddeley withdrew the engine from the market; Rolls-Royce subsequently offered the Spey Junior, a simplified derivative of the Rolls-Royce Spey, and from the first prototype onward the F28 was exclusively powered by Spey variants. The first commercial order came from the German charter airline LTU on 17 November 1965. The prototype F28-1000, registration PH-JHG, made its maiden flight on 9 May 1967. On 24 February 1969 Fokker board member Kees van Meerten received the Certificate of Airworthiness from Willem Jan Kruys, Director General of the Dutch National Aviation Authority, and the type entered revenue service with Braathens SAFE on 28 March 1969. American manufacturer Fairchild Aircraft at one point considered building its own derivative, the Fairchild 228, but this did not reach production and Fairchild instead acted as a distributor for the existing F28. Fokker went on to develop stretched and re-engined variants through the 1970s, and production ended in 1987 after 241 airframes had been built, with the design lineage carried forward into the Fokker 70 and Fokker 100.

Design & Specifications

The F28 is a low-wing cantilever monoplane of relatively straight, low-speed-optimised planform, fitted with a T-tail and retractable tricycle landing gear. Its wing was kept deliberately simple, without leading-edge slats, and Fowler flaps were used for high-lift performance; de-icing was achieved using engine bleed air rather than more complex mechanical systems. The aircraft was powered throughout its production life by variants of the Rolls-Royce Spey turbofan, mounted in pods either side of the rear fuselage; the F28-1000 used two Rolls-Royce RB.183 Spey Mk 555-15 low-bypass turbofans, each rated at 9,850 lbf (43.9 kN) of thrust. The later F28-4000 introduced quieter Rolls-Royce Spey 555-15H engines together with a redesigned cockpit and a modified, larger wing with additional overwing exits. A notable and unusual design feature was the hydraulically operated tail airbrake, in which the two halves of the tail cone opened to increase drag; this arrangement, later echoed on the BAe 146/Avro RJ, also allowed engines to be kept at higher power settings during critical phases of flight such as approach, reducing spool-up lag if a go-around was needed.

Performance & Handling

The F28 was designed to be markedly faster than the turboprop types it was intended to complement, notably the F27 Friendship and Douglas DC-3, while remaining deliberately slower in cruise than many contemporary pure jets such as the DC-9 and BAC 1-11. This trade-off allowed the use of a relatively straight, low-mounted wing and gave favourable low-speed handling characteristics, enabling the aircraft to operate from around 85% of the airfields already used by the F27 and DC-3. Fokker and industry commentary at the time noted that the design could achieve roughly double the productivity of the preceding F27 on comparable routes.

Variants

The F28-1000 was the original production version, powered by Rolls-Royce Spey Mk 555-15 turbofans and seating up to around 65 passengers. The F28-2000 was a stretched derivative with an extended fuselage, first flown on 28 April 1971, increasing capacity to up to 79 passengers. The F28-3000 followed as a further development within the same family. The F28-4000, first flown on 20 October 1976, combined the stretched Mk 2000 fuselage with a larger wing, additional overwing exits and quieter Rolls-Royce Spey 555-15H engines, raising seating capacity to up to 85 passengers; it became the most commercially successful and most widely built F28 variant. A locally produced American derivative, the Fairchild 228, was considered by Fairchild Aircraft but never entered production, Fairchild instead distributing the standard F28. A carrier onboard delivery (COD) proposal for the US Navy, featuring folding wings, strengthened landing gear and an arresting hook, was put forward by Fokker in 1981 but was not adopted.

Operational Use

The F28 entered airline service with Braathens SAFE on 28 March 1969 and went on to be operated by a wide range of carriers across Europe, South America, Africa and the Asia-Pacific region, reflecting its suitability for shorter regional routes and less developed airfields. Notable operators included Garuda Indonesia and Biman Bangladesh Airlines, while Swedish carrier Linjeflyg was one of the largest operators of the type. In the United States, Piedmont Airlines flew the F28-1000. Production ended in 1987 after 241 aircraft had been completed, with the type's role subsequently taken over by the derivative Fokker 70 and Fokker 100 designs. Into the 2020s a small number of F28s remained in limited government and military service, including with Argentina's LADE.

In the Simulator

The F28 is being modelled for Microsoft Flight Simulator by Just Flight as the F28 Professional, covering all four production variants from the Mk 1000 through to the Mk 4000, developed with reference to a real ex-airline aircraft, PH-CHN, at AM&TS (Curio) Woensdrecht. The add-on reproduces the type's distinctive systems and mechanical features in detail, including its dynamic wing-flex, lift dumpers and the characteristic tail-mounted airbrake, together with custom-coded hydraulic, electrical, fuel and pressurisation systems modelled on real-world Flight Crew Operating Manuals. The cockpit is built around Captain, Co-Pilot and jump seat positions with fully animated switches and period-authentic navigation equipment such as RMI and HSI displays, with optional modern GNS430 or UNS-1 FMS navigation fits available for those wanting updated capability. Because the many real-world operators configured their F28s differently over the decades, the simulated cockpit has been set up to match the specific reference aircraft visited during development, giving a consistent and authentic environment for study and route flying of this short-field-capable regional jet.
